Solar Energy Take-Up Across the World

Ā  The global solar power industry has experienced remarkable growth since the 2009 recession. The growth rate each year between 2007 to 2011 was around 70%. China Continues to Dominate Global Renewable Energy Market

Ā  Ernst & Young released late August their quarterly globalĀ Renewable Energy Country Attractiveness IndicesĀ report which showed that China is set to continue it domination of the global renewable energy market, as US elections and political support in Europe prevent other countries from keeping up.
